Diabetes Prevention
One out of every three
children can expect to get
diabetes in their lifetime. For
some ethnicities, the number
can be as high as one in
every two children. This
surge in life-threatening illness
is mainly type II diabetes,
which is 90% preventable 95%
percent of the time. East
West Kung Fu is a member of
the MADDCAP program
(Martial artists Defeat
Diabetes Community Action
Program) and educates all its
students in diabetes
prevention.

Social Change
In every community, there will be teenagers at risk of dying through
reckless driving, or drug or alcohol abuse. Through martial arts,
students can learn the self respect, discipline and leadership abilities
to protect themselves from peer pressure, and improve their
decision-making skills.
